Google Analytics 4(GA4)配置教程,从入门到精通
本文目录导读:
- 引言
- 1. 什么是Google Analytics 4(GA4)?
- 2. 如何创建GA4账户?
- 3. 安装GA4跟踪代码
- 4. 配置关键事件追踪
- 5. 设置转化(Conversions)
- 6. 数据验证与调试
- 7. 高级配置(可选)
- 8. 常见问题与解决方案
- 9. 结语
Google Analytics 4(GA4)是Google推出的新一代网站和应用数据分析工具,相较于传统的Universal Analytics(UA),GA4提供了更强大的跨平台追踪、AI驱动的洞察以及更灵活的数据模型,许多用户对如何正确配置GA4仍然感到困惑,本教程将详细介绍GA4的配置步骤,帮助您快速上手并优化数据收集。

什么是Google Analytics 4(GA4)?
GA4是Google Analytics的最新版本,于2020年正式推出,旨在替代Universal Analytics(UA),它的核心特点包括:
- 事件驱动的数据模型:不再依赖传统的页面浏览和会话统计,而是基于用户交互事件(如点击、滚动、表单提交等)。
- 跨平台追踪:可同时追踪网站、移动应用(iOS/Android)等多渠道数据。
- 增强的隐私控制:适应全球数据隐私法规(如GDPR、CCPA)。
- AI预测分析:提供自动化的用户行为预测,如潜在流失用户或高价值转化用户。
由于UA将于2023年7月停止处理新数据,迁移到GA4已成为必要步骤。
如何创建GA4账户?
步骤1:登录Google Analytics
访问Google Analytics官网,使用您的Google账号登录。
步骤2:创建新GA4属性
- 点击 “管理”(左下角齿轮图标)。
- 在 “账户” 列,选择现有账户或创建新账户。
- 在 “属性” 列,点击 “创建属性”。
- 选择 “Google Analytics 4” 并填写属性名称、时区和货币。
步骤3:设置数据流(Data Stream)
GA4支持三种数据流:
- 网站(Web):适用于网站分析。
- iOS应用:适用于苹果设备应用。
- Android应用:适用于安卓设备应用。
以网站为例:
- 点击 “添加数据流” > “网站”。
- 输入网站URL和流名称。
- 启用 “增强型测量”(自动追踪页面浏览、滚动、点击等)。
- 点击 “创建流”,系统会生成一个 “测量ID”(如
G-XXXXXXXXXX)。
安装GA4跟踪代码
方法1:使用Google Tag Manager(推荐)
- 登录Google Tag Manager。
- 创建新容器(如“GA4 Tracking”)。
- 添加 “Google Analytics: GA4 配置” 标签,输入测量ID。
- 设置触发器为 “All Pages”(适用于全站追踪)。
- 发布容器,并在网站头部插入GTM代码。
方法2:手动添加GA4代码
如果未使用GTM,可直接在网站的 <head> 部分插入以下代码:
<!-- Global site tag (gtag.js) - Google Analytics -->
<script async src="https://www.googletagmanager.com/gtag/js?id=G-XXXXXXXXXX"></script>
<script>
window.dataLayer = window.dataLayer || [];
function gtag(){dataLayer.push(arguments);}
gtag('js', new Date());
gtag('config', 'G-XXXXXXXXXX');
</script>
(替换 G-XXXXXXXXXX 为您的测量ID)
配置关键事件追踪
GA4默认追踪部分事件(如页面浏览),但自定义事件需手动设置。
常见事件配置
表单提交追踪
在GTM中:
- 创建 “GA4 事件” 标签。
- 事件名称设为
form_submit。 - 设置触发器为 “表单提交”。
按钮点击追踪
- 创建 “GA4 事件” 标签。
- 事件名称设为
button_click。 - 设置触发器为 “点击 - 仅链接” 或 “点击 - 所有元素”。
滚动深度追踪
- 在GA4数据流设置中启用 “增强型测量” > “滚动深度”。
- 或通过GTM自定义事件实现。
设置转化(Conversions)
转化是指对业务至关重要的用户行为(如购买、注册)。
步骤1:标记关键事件为转化
- 进入GA4 “管理” > “事件”。
- 找到目标事件(如
purchase),切换 “标记为转化”。
步骤2:导入Google Ads转化(可选)
- 在Google Ads中关联GA4账户。
- 在GA4 “管理” > “Google Ads关联” 中启用转化导出。
数据验证与调试
方法1:使用GA4实时报告
进入 “实时” 报告,检查用户活动是否正常记录。
方法2:Google Tag Assistant
安装Chrome扩展 Tag Assistant,检查代码是否正确触发。
方法3:DebugView模式
在GTM预览模式或GA4 DebugView中查看详细事件数据。
高级配置(可选)
用户ID追踪
适用于登录用户跨设备分析:
- 在GA4 “管理” > “数据设置” > “用户ID” 中启用。
- 在代码中传递用户ID:
gtag('config', 'G-XXXXXXXXXX', { 'user_id': 'USER_ID' });
自定义维度与指标
在 “自定义定义” 中添加业务特定参数(如会员等级、产品类别)。
数据过滤
排除内部IP或测试流量:
- 进入 “管理” > “数据设置” > “数据过滤”。
- 添加过滤器排除特定IP。
常见问题与解决方案
Q1:GA4数据与UA不一致?
- GA4采用不同数据模型,直接对比可能不准确。
- 建议并行运行UA和GA4一段时间以校准数据。
Q2:事件未显示在报告中?
- 检查代码是否正确触发。
- 确保事件已注册并等待24小时(GA4数据有延迟)。
Q3:如何恢复误删数据?
- GA4无数据恢复功能,建议定期导出数据备份。
GA4的配置虽然比UA复杂,但其强大的功能和未来兼容性使其成为必备工具,按照本教程逐步操作,您可以顺利完成GA4的部署并优化数据分析流程。
如需进一步学习,可参考:
- Google Analytics官方文档
- Google Analytics Academy(免费课程)
希望本教程对您有所帮助!🚀